Abstract
Two-hundred and nineteen recently germinated jojoba seedlings were located in October and November 1974 and observed monthly for 12 months thereafter. Total seedling survival was 12%. Seedlings in a protected situation (associated with adult jojoba shrubs, other woody perennials, or rocks) had a significantly higher survival rate (22%), by December 1975, than seedlings growing in exposed sites (6%). Seedling mortality appeared to be related to both climatic (drought and freezing) and biotic (rodent) factors. Periods of vegetative growth and seedling germination were noted. Seedling establishment (germination plus seedling survival) of perennial is difficult in the Sonoran Desert. This is probably attributable to temporal variability of harsh climatic conditions, especially just above and below the soil surface, and biotic factors. The first 12 months of seedling life are particularly critical to seedling establishment (Shreve 1911, 1917). Until we have a much better understanding of seedling establishment patterns in desert perennial plants, it will remain difficult to interpret the evolutionary significance of their life history phenomena. Jojoba, Simmondsia chinensis [Link] Schneider, is a dioecious evergreen perennial shrub widely distributed in the Sonoran Desert (Gentry 1958; Sherbrooke and Haase 1974). This study of seedling establishment success, conducted under natural conditions during a 12month period following germination, was undertaken to determine the rate of jojoba seedling survival, factors contributing to seedling mortality, and time of germination and seedling growth. Of particular concern was an evaluation of the hypothesis that jojoba seedlings germinating under shrubs and trees, or associated with shading rocks, have a higher survival rate than seedlings germinating in more exposed sites.
